On the change of cardiac action potential with age: a study in dogs

The action potential duration (APD) was measured using an Ag-AgCl electrode, in open chest anaesthetised dogs (n = 8) and puppies, 4 to 6 months old (n=8), with complete atrio-ventricular dissociation and β-adrenergic blockade. They were paced in the control period at a frequency of 120 beats·min−1....
